Susanne Pini

Principal - National Director of Retail + Mixed Use + Workplace Australia

Professional Background

Susanne Pini is a distinguished architect and thought leader in the field of architecture, with a special focus on retail, mixed-use developments, and workplace design across Australia. As the Principal Director of HDR's Retail + Mixed Use + Workplace sector, Susanne is committed to transforming ordinary urban landscapes into vibrant, immersive spaces that enhance community engagement and functionality. With a deep understanding of master planning, town centers, and retail architecture, she has played a pivotal role in shifting perceptions of shopping centers from isolated commercial spaces to integral components of the community.

For over a decade, Susanne has driven innovative design practices that prioritize people and sustainability. Her approach synthesizes various design disciplines—from architectural to urban planning—ensuring that every project reflects the unique character of its surroundings while serving the needs of the community. Susanne's work is characterized by a commitment to excellence, demonstrated through her extensive portfolio that showcases a variety of successful projects across Australia.

Education and Achievements

Susanne Pini earned her Bachelor of Architecture (BArch) with Honours from the University of Technology Sydney, where she honed her architectural skills and developed a passion for creating inclusive urban environments.
